  • Publication number: 20130316036
    Abstract: A mold-tool system (100), comprising: an assembly (101); and a runner assembly (600) supporting the assembly (101). The runner assembly (600) is configured to provide an access portal (103) configured to permit access to the assembly (101) by a removal assembly (105), so that the assembly (101) may be removed from the runner assembly (600) and replaced. The assembly (101) includes: a position-adjustment assembly (102) configured to interact with a stem-actuation plate (606) connected with a stem assembly (609) of a nozzle assembly (620). The position-adjustment assembly (102) configured to adjust an amount of stem protrusion (794) of the stem assembly (609) relative to a mold assembly (700). The runner assembly (600) supports actuatable movement of the stem-actuation plate (606). Access portal (103) configured to permit access to the position-adjustment assembly (102).
